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

ci: use ubuntu-22 for the aarch64 workers #34383

Merged
merged 1 commit into from
Jan 25, 2023

Conversation

v1v
Copy link
Member

@v1v v1v commented Jan 25, 2023

What does this PR do?

Use ubuntu-22 for the aarch64 workers

Why is it important?

Leftover from #34315

Unfortunately the default behaviour with the CI builds on PRs don't trigger arm but only with merge commits, though you can use arm label to enable the those specific stages... I somehow missed that particular feature :/

@v1v v1v added the arm Enable builds in the CI for ARM testing label Jan 25, 2023
@botelastic botelastic bot added the needs_team Indicates that the issue/PR needs a Team:* label label Jan 25, 2023
@v1v v1v requested review from kuisathaverat and a team January 25, 2023 08:28
@mergify mergify bot assigned v1v Jan 25, 2023
@mergify
Copy link
Contributor

mergify bot commented Jan 25, 2023

This pull request does not have a backport label.
If this is a bug or security fix, could you label this PR @v1v? 🙏.
For such, you'll need to label your PR with:

  • The upcoming major version of the Elastic Stack
  • The upcoming minor version of the Elastic Stack (if you're not pushing a breaking change)

To fixup this pull request, you need to add the backport labels for the needed
branches, such as:

  • backport-v8./d.0 is the label to automatically backport to the 8./d branch. /d is the digit

@v1v v1v added automation Team:Automation Label for the Observability productivity team backport-7.17 Automated backport to the 7.17 branch with mergify backport-v8.6.0 Automated backport with mergify labels Jan 25, 2023
@botelastic botelastic bot removed the needs_team Indicates that the issue/PR needs a Team:* label label Jan 25, 2023
@v1v
Copy link
Member Author

v1v commented Jan 25, 2023

image

arm workers are now used and the stages are passing correctly!

@v1v
Copy link
Member Author

v1v commented Jan 25, 2023

I'll merge this now since the ARM specific stages for the main pipeline have been tested correctly

@elasticmachine
Copy link
Collaborator

💚 Build Succeeded

the below badges are clickable and redirect to their specific view in the CI or DOCS
Pipeline View Test View Changes Artifacts preview preview

Expand to view the summary

Build stats

  • Start Time: 2023-01-25T08:28:33.661+0000

  • Duration: 180 min 28 sec

Test stats 🧪

Test Results
Failed 0
Passed 35348
Skipped 2592
Total 37940

💚 Flaky test report

Tests succeeded.

🤖 GitHub comments

Expand to view the GitHub comments

To re-run your PR in the CI, just comment with:

  • /test : Re-trigger the build.

  • /package : Generate the packages and run the E2E tests.

  • /beats-tester : Run the installation tests with beats-tester.

  • run elasticsearch-ci/docs : Re-trigger the docs validation. (use unformatted text in the comment!)

@v1v v1v marked this pull request as ready for review January 25, 2023 11:29
@v1v v1v requested review from a team as code owners January 25, 2023 11:29
@v1v v1v requested review from belimawr and rdner and removed request for a team January 25, 2023 11:29
@v1v v1v merged commit df97453 into elastic:main Jan 25, 2023
mergify bot pushed a commit that referenced this pull request Jan 25, 2023
mergify bot pushed a commit that referenced this pull request Jan 25, 2023
v1v added a commit that referenced this pull request Jan 30, 2023
cmacknz pushed a commit that referenced this pull request Jan 30, 2023
chrisberkhout pushed a commit that referenced this pull request Jun 1, 2023
mergify bot pushed a commit that referenced this pull request Jun 21, 2023
cmacknz pushed a commit that referenced this pull request Jun 21, 2023
Similar to #34383

(cherry picked from commit b5226ae)

Co-authored-by: Victor Martinez <[email protected]>
@cmacknz
Copy link
Member

cmacknz commented Jun 22, 2023

@Mergifyio backport 7.17

@mergify
Copy link
Contributor

mergify bot commented Jun 22, 2023

backport 7.17

✅ Backports have been created

cmacknz pushed a commit to cmacknz/beats that referenced this pull request Jun 22, 2023
cmacknz added a commit that referenced this pull request Jun 22, 2023
* ci: use ubuntu-22 for the aarch64 workers (#34383)

* Update arm platform for elastic-agent.

---------

Co-authored-by: Victor Martinez <[email protected]>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
arm Enable builds in the CI for ARM testing automation backport-7.17 Automated backport to the 7.17 branch with mergify backport-v8.6.0 Automated backport with mergify Team:Automation Label for the Observability productivity team
Projects
None yet
Development

Successfully merging this pull request may close these issues.

5 participants